Margarita (Lime) Ice Cream
Recipe from Nigella Lawson

Ingredients
125ml lime juice (about 4 limes)
2 tablespoons tequila (optional)
3 tablespoons cointreau (or triple sec) (optional)
150g icing sugar
500ml double cream

Method

Squeeze the limes then add the juice to a large bowl and mix with the tequila, cointreau and icing sugar.

Add the cream and whisk until thick but not stiff.

Pour in to a airtight container and freeze overnight.

I grated the zest from one lime and sprinkled it over the ice cream before freezing.
